Election Day is Tuesday, November 4, 2014, but there are several options to vote prior to that date.
Voter registration ends Monday, October 6th. If you're not sure if you (or your recent High School graduate!) is registered, click here to search the Franklin County Registered Voter Database.You can download a voter registration form here, and mail to: Franklin County Board of Elections, PO BOX 182111, Columbus, OH 43218-2111 Early voting begins Tuesday, October 7th. In person, registered voters may cast their ballots at the Franklin County Board of Elections Office, 1700 Morse Road (the old Kohl’s building) between 8:00 a.m. and 5:00 p.m. (Monday through Friday), and October 25th from 8 a.m. to 4:00 p.m.; November 1st from 8:00 a.m. to 4:00 p.m., November 2nd from 1:00 p.m. to 5:00 p.m., and Monday November 3rd from 8: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m. Or by mail, voters may fill out an Absentee Ballot. Every registered voter received an Absentee Ballot Request Form in the mail, or you can download one here. Simply complete and return the form to the Franklin County Board of Elections and an absentee ballot form will be mailed to you. Once you receive your ballot, complete it and send it back to the Franklin County Board of Elections. All absentee ballots must be received at the board of elections office by 7:30 p.m. on November 4th. Voters should request their ballots as early as possible in order to meet this deadline.
